基于FPGA的交通灯控制课程设计报告.docx
《基于FPGA的交通灯控制课程设计报告.docx》由会员分享,可在线阅读,更多相关《基于FPGA的交通灯控制课程设计报告.docx(12页珍藏版)》请在三一文库上搜索。
1、.课程设计报告设计题目:基于FPGA的交通灯控制 专 业 班 级 学 号 学生姓名 指导教师 设计时间 教师评分 2012年12月14日;10目 录1、概述11实验目的11.2课程设计的组成部分12、交通灯设计的内容23、总结53.1课程设计进行过程及步骤53.2体会收获及建议94、教师评语95、成绩91、概述1实验目的(1)熟悉利用Quarturs开发数字电路的基本流程和Quarturs软件的相关操作。(2)掌握基本的设计思路,软件环境参数配置,仿真,管脚分配,利用JTAG/AS进行下载等基本操作。(3)了解VerilogHDL语言设计或原理图设计方法。(4)通过本知识点的学习,了解交通灯的
2、工作原理,掌握其逻辑功能及设计方法。1.2课程设计的组成部分(1)系统功能:实现十字路口的交通灯显示。(2)系统要求:a. 要求控制南北、东西方向各3个灯(红、黄、绿)的亮灭;b. 用LED0-LED5六个灯来代表红绿灯,其中LED0-LED2表示南北方向的红,黄,绿灯,LED3-LED5表示东西方向的红,黄,绿灯。c. 要求南北方向红灯亮5秒,同时东西方向绿灯亮3秒,绿灯结束后,东西方向黄灯亮2秒。转东西红灯亮5秒,同时南北绿灯亮3秒,绿灯结束后,南北黄灯亮2秒,一直循环。(3)引脚分配:2、交通灯设计的内容主程序module jtd(clk,led);input clk; output7:
3、0led; reg7:0led; reg4:0state; always (posedge clk)begin state = state + 5'b00001; case(state) 5'b00000:led<=8'b00001001;5'b00001:led<=8'b00100001; /南北红灯亮5秒,东西绿灯亮3秒,在转东西黄灯2秒5'b00010:led<=8'b00000000;5'b00011:led<=8'b00100001;5'b00100:led<=8'b
4、00000000;5'b00101:led<=8'b00100001;5'b00110:led<=8'b00000000;5'b00111:led<=8'b00010001; 5'b01000:led<=8'b00000000;5'b01001:led<=8'b00010001; 5'b01010:led<=8'b00000000;5'b01011:led<=8'b00001100; /东西红灯亮5秒,南北绿灯亮3秒,在转南北黄灯2秒5
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 基于 FPGA 交通灯 控制 课程设计 报告
链接地址:https://www.31doc.com/p-12679260.html